- The distance between Homer, Ak, Usa and Prachuap Khiri Khan, Thailand is approximately 9,890 km or 6,146 mi.
- To reach Homer, Ak in this distance one would set out from Prachuap Khiri Khan bearing 28.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Homer, Ak bearing 112° or ESE .
- Homer, Ak has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c) whereas Prachuap Khiri Khan has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As).
- Homer, Ak is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Prachuap Khiri Khan is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 24 °C (43.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.1 °C (23.6°F) more in Homer, Ak.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 509.1 mm (20 in) less which is equivalent to 509.1 l/m² (12.49 US gal/ft²) or 5,091,000 l/ha (544,262 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 42.6° lower in Homer, Ak than in Prachuap Khiri Khan.
